摘要
With the rapid development of the Internet of Things(IoT), Location-Based Services(LBS) are becoming more and more popular. However, for the users being served, how to protect their location privacy has become a growing concern. This has led to great difficulty in establishing trust between the users and the service providers, hindering the development of LBS for more comprehensive functions. In this paper, we first establish a strong identity verification mechanism to ensure the authentication security of the system and then design a new location privacy protection mechanism based on the privacy proximity test problem. This mechanism not only guarantees the confidentiality of the user's information during the subsequent information interaction and dynamic data transmission, but also meets the service provider's requirements for related data.
